The good: The Samsung Sync has an attractive design that includes a great internal display. It also supports Cingular Music and offers a full range of features, including support for HSDPA networks, stereo Bluetooth, and a satisfying 2-megapixel camera.
The bad: The Samsung Sync had average call quality at times, and we weren't impressed by the navigation controls or keypad. Also, it doesn't come with a USB cable in the box.
The bottom line: The Samsung Sync is a great choice for music-mad cell phone users, but its call quality could be better.
